DEPARTMENT OF LABOR
Bureau of Labor Statistics
Business Research Advisory Council; Notice of Meetings and Agenda
The regular Fall meetings of the Business Research Advisory Council
and its Committees will be held on October 25 and 26, 1995. All of the
meetings will be held in the Conference Center of the Postal Square
Building, 2 Massachusetts Avenue, NE., Washington, DC.
The Business Research Advisory Council and its committees advise
the Bureau of Labor Statistics with respect to technical matters
associated with the Bureau's programs. Membership consists of technical
officers from American business and industry.
